I dove with White Manta in the Andaman twice last season and plan on diving with them again at least twice this coming season. It's not cheap. They have Nitrox; also not cheap.

I've been doing liveaboards in Thailand since the 90s, so I've been on a lot of boats; everything from the decrepit old Short Cut II, right on up.

White Manta is a nice, comfortable boat with a fine crew. I'm sure there are many others.
 
Buadhai, you've also been on Deep Andaman Queen (the former Queen Scuba). About the same price as White Manta. Both are mid-priced (rather than luxury) vessels. (We don't have many high-end options in Thailand, actually.)
